Null/Space Conversion

Toggle to ENABLE or DISABLE. This feature substitutes spaces for leading and embedded
nulls when updates are sent to the host, if enabled.

Delayed Power On Notify

Toggle to ENABLE or DISABLE. This feature limits the number of sessions notifying the
host at power-on, in order to alleviate excessive line traffic. LINCS does this by delaying the
Power On Notify sent to the host for background sessions until the end user toggles sessions.
It should be noted that this feature should be disabled for Non-SNA operations where consoles
are in use. If a coax terminal has multiple console sessions and the feature is enabled, then
only the first console session will come active. Background console sessions will appear to be
powered off, and the console function will roll to an alternate.

ASCII/TELNET Password

This option applies to ASCII displays defined to have a switched Line Type on the ASCII Port
Options panel for this line, and to Telnet displays. This password may also apply to TN3270
clients defined on the TN3270 Client Definition panel that include a ‘PW’ in the client type
description.

The password can be up to eight alphanumeric characters, and is case sensitive. If a user with
an ASCII display calls the modem attached to the switched ASCII line, this password must be
entered to allow access to the LINCS node.

Number of Days Password is Valid

The value entered into this field indicates how long the password is to be valid. A value of
‘000’ is interpreted as indefinitely. When the password expires, the user will be prompted to
enter the Supervisor Password (as configured on the General Options panel). When within a
week of the passwords expiration, a message will be displayed at password prompt time to
indicate how much longer the password is good for. You must press the PF4 key (twice) to
update the password information, prior to leaving this panel.

Password Beginning Date

This field is updated by LINCS when a PF4 has been entered twice on this panel with a non-
zero value in the ‘Number of Days Password is Valid’ field. The current date is entered into to
this field by LINCS at update time.
